SRMJEEE 2025: Announcing the Exam Schedule for Engineering Aspirants

SRM Institute of Science and Technology (SRMIST) has officially announced the exam schedule for the SRM Joint Engineering Entrance Exam (SRMJEEE) for the academic year 2025. 

This is a golden opportunity for aspiring engineers to secure admission to one of India’s most prestigious institutions, known for its advanced educational practices, cutting-edge research, and world-class infrastructure. 

In an effort to provide flexibility and convenience for candidates, SRMIST has announced that the SRMJEEE exam will be conducted in three distinct phases. 

This approach is designed to accommodate students from various academic backgrounds and regions, ensuring that they have the best chance of success. Below, we’ll take a closer look at the timeline for the SRMJEEE exam in 2025, along with important details that candidates must keep in mind.

Details for SRMJEEE 2025:

SRMJEEE PhaseExam DatesApplication DeadlineMode of Examination
Phase 122nd April 2025 to 27th April 202516th April 2025Remote Protected Online Mode (from home using Desktop/Laptop)
Phase 212th June 2025 to 17th June 20256th June 2025Remote Protected Online Mode (from home using Desktop/Laptop)
Phase 34th July 2025 to 5th July 202530th June 2025Remote Protected Online Mode (from home using Desktop/Laptop)

 

To make the exam process as accessible and secure as possible, SRMIST has introduced the Remote Protected Online Mode for SRMJEEE. In this mode, candidates can take the exam from the comfort of their homes using their desktop or laptop. This online format offers significant convenience, especially for students from distant regions who may find it difficult to travel to an exam center.

How to Apply for SRMJEEE 2025

The application process for SRMJEEE 2025 is entirely online. Candidates must visit the official SRMIST website to register and complete the application form. The process is simple and involves the following steps:

  1. Registration: First, candidates need to create an account on the SRMIST portal.
  2. Fill in the Application Form: Provide personal, academic, and contact details, and select the preferred phase for the exam.
  3. Payment of Application Fee: The application fee can be paid online through various modes such as debit/credit cards or net banking.
  4. Submit Documents: Upload the required documents, such as a passport-size photograph, signature, and proof of eligibility.
  5. Confirmation: Once the application is submitted successfully, candidates will receive an acknowledgment email with their application details.
